DEEPER KNOWLEDGE RECORDS - NEW RELEASES - MARCH 2011
CHANNEL 1 10" 45 RPM
DKR-037-JJ
MCWONER - NUH FIRE IT/HIGHER REGION
DKR-038-JJ
BARRY BROWN/ANGELA PRINCE - OVER ME/JOKER LOVER
DKR-039-JJ
HORACE ANDY - WHY OH WHY/SATISFY ME
*BOTH PREVIOUSLY UNRELEASED*
DKR-040-JJ
UNKNOWN ARTIST - ROCKS & MOUNTAINS/DUB
*PREVIOUSLY UNRELEASED*

we released what was on master tape. which is probably why you think it is the "least rare" cut - the tune was mostly cut on dub plate using this tape. it is certainly possible/likely there are other custom/one-off mixes, but this is the one which was available to us. personally, i do not qualitatively judge tunes by their "rarity" so the idea that this might be the "least rare" mix of an already very obscure, half-forgotten and mysterious tune was of no concern to me. it's a small miracle in the first place that this tape still existed and that we could locate it and use it. anyway, considering the way tunes like this were generally disseminated at the time, i personally question the authenticity of these endless "mixes" of rare tunes which circulate on the internet. in summation, you're welcome.
